124942 Also, I cant level up more, entire team level 23/24 and whit wild pokemon level 10/12 it takes ages. Starmie continues to onehit all my pokemon.

 

Ah that. This is the part of the game where you would realize how to beat an opponent not relying mostly on direct counters. Misty's Starmie has icy wind which is the weakness of most plant types. Starmie also has one of the fastest speed so it may always attack first.

 

During that time I also chose a charmander starter so I used a gloom (lvl24)and a pidgeotto(lvl 23). Gloom as my first to wipe the first two poke, then make it attack starmie and let it die. Then i let my pidgeotto finish starmie(pidgeotto laso has one of the fastest speed)

I took me a while to beat misty. I had a level 25 Charmeleon, Nidorina, and Bronzor. So two of them were weak to starmie. My strategy was use nido to beat the first 2, and hypnosis starmie then sweep with 2 dragon rages. It took a few tries but I did it. With only the team I planned to use. I never caught a pokemon for 1 specific encounter. I always used my team and made plans to win. Its hard but its definitely possible to do.
